Chris Pratt Auditioned for Two Other MCU Roles BeforeGuardians of the Galaxy

Pratt was pretty devastated after being rejected from playing two MCU roles. Pratt revealed that he did audition forCaptain Americawhich eventually went toChris Evansand attempted to grab a role inThor, however, he did not get a call from the makers ofChris Hemsworth’sfranchise.“Oh man, yeah I did [audition for Captain America]. I auditioned for them all,”Pratt recalled.

“I had a rough run with Marvel. I auditioned for Thor, but not even to be Thor! But to be one of the sidekick guys and I didn’t get a callback. Yeah. Usually you get a little bit of feedback and I remember the casting director was like, ‘Wow, you really made a big choice there.’ Which is code for like, ‘Hey, dial back the acting there, guy.’”

Perhaps, it was for the best but it was a bit disappointing for the actor to not get the part to be even a sidekick of the MightyThor. WhenGuardians of the Galaxywas in development, Pratt revealed, he did not even want to go for an audition due to his past experiences with the studio.“It got to the point where I was never gonna audition for Marvel again,”Pratt said.“It was like, ‘This is stupid; I’m never gonna be in a Marvel movie,’”he added. Eventually, Pratt got the lead role and he has done a splendid job pushing the franchise to success with the band of his co-stars.
